The maiden edition of the Schools Arts Mentorship Programme (SAMP) Train was held on Friday, July 17, 2026, at Seeds After The Order of Christ Academy (SATOC).
The programme gave the students the rare opportunity to interact with renowned Ghanaian poet, author and surgeon, Professor Ladé Wosornu.
It connected a budding generation of creatives with a poet whose works they have studied in class for years. It marked the first edition of the SATOC Academy Art Mentorship Programme with Professor Ladé Wosornu.
The event featured an infographic presentation of selected poems by Professor Wosornu, reviews and performances of the poems, as well as a one-on-one interaction with the literary icon on his writing career, life experiences as a creative and accomplished surgeon, and guidance on becoming a successful poet and author.

Students were also given the opportunity to engage Professor Wosornu on issues relating to his literary works, creative journey and the discipline required to excel in both the arts and the sciences.

The Schools Arts Mentorship Programme (SAMP) Train is an initiative aimed at contributing to the development of Ghana’s creative arts sector. It is designed to bridge the gap between budding creatives and established artists by creating opportunities for mentorship, knowledge sharing and practical engagement.

It is the brainchild of Playhouse.kom. The maiden edition was produced in partnership with the Professor Ladé Wosornu Trust and Seeds After The Order of Christ Academy (SATOC).
